In the printing industry, EC is widely recognized for its role in enhancing ink performance. As a rheology modifier, it controls viscosity and flow, ensuring optimal application in gravure, flexographic, and screen printing processes. Its function as a dispersant aids in maintaining pigment stability, leading to consistent color quality. The coatings industry also benefits significantly from Ethyl Cellulose. EC is used in specialty coatings to improve properties such as flexibility, toughness, and moisture resistance. It acts as a binder and rheology modifier in paper coatings, enhancing gloss and block resistance, while its application in glass coatings provides crucial rheological control and clean burnout properties. Adhesives represent another key area where Ethyl Cellulose demonstrates its value. As a binder in solvent-based adhesive formulations, EC improves green bond strength and contributes to the overall cohesion of the adhesive. This is particularly important in applications requiring immediate bond strength after application, such as in heat-seal packaging.
